High-Tg Epoxy Resin for APG Process | Vacuum Casting & Electrical Insulating
LE-8216/LH-8216: UL-Certified Room Temperature Cure Epoxy for CT/PT Potting & Encapsulation
Flame-Retardant | UV/Weather-Resistant | High Dielectric Strength

Engineered for transformer encapsulation in Current Transformers (CT) and Potential Transformers (PT), LE-8216/LH-8216 delivers fast room temperature curing, eliminating energy-intensive ovens. This UL-certified, flame-retardant epoxy system combines a modified cyclic aliphatic epoxy resin (LE-8216) and weather-resistant anhydride hardener (LH-8216) for superior electrical insulation, moisture resistance, and vibration damping in demanding indoor/outdoor environments.

Key Features & Benefits
  • Fast Ambient Cure: Saves energy with rapid curing at room temperature.
  • Robust Protection: Shields CT/PT units from thermal shock, contaminants, and mechanical stress.
  • Superior Insulation: High dielectric strength (>18 kV/mm) for high-voltage applications.
  • Flame Retardant: UL 94 V-0 certified for safety-critical installations.
  • Weatherproof: Exceptional UV/environmental resilience for outdoor use.
  • Low-Viscosity Formulation: Penetrates intricate coils for void-free gap filling.
Applications

Ideal for:

  • Transformer potting & encapsulation (CT/PT units)
  • Medium/high-voltage insulators, bushings, and switchgear
  • Electrical components requiring moisture-resistant protection
  • Flame-retardant insulation in power infrastructure
Processing Methods
Method Description
Vacuum Gravity Casting Traditional method for bubble-free transformer encapsulation under vacuum.
Automatic Pressure Gelation (APG) High-efficiency process for mass production of CT PT epoxy components.
Material Properties
Property Value/Description
Curing Temperature Room temperature (20-25°C)
Dielectric Strength >18 kV/mm
Thermal Shock Resistance Excellent (ASTM D2519)
Viscosity Low (optimized for deep gap filling)
Flame Rating UL 94 V-0 certified
Color Options Customizable via LC-series paste
Formulation Guide
Component Product Proportion (pbw)
Epoxy Resin LE-8216 100
Hardener LH-8216 100
Filler Silica Powder 280-350
Colorant LC-Series* 3

*Add LC-series paste for UV-stable pigmentation.

Why Choose LE-8216/LH-8216?

This electrical-grade epoxy system excels as a potting compound for transformer manufacturing, offering unmatched electrical component protection. Its saturated cyclic aliphatic structure ensures long-term stability under thermal cycling, while silica-filled reinforcement enhances mechanical strength and dielectric performance. Compatible with vacuum casting and APG processes, it integrates seamlessly into existing production lines--ideal for creating reliable, flame-retardant CT/PT encapsulation with minimal energy input.
